Things to Know Before You Go
Seeing a show at the Colosseum is a must for concert lovers.
The venue is part of the Caesars Palace complex, which encompasses shops, casinos, and restaurants.
Wheelchair-accessible seating is available at every price level.
To pick up online tickets, bring photo ID and the credit card used to purchase
How to Get There
Conveniently located in the centre of the Strip, The Colosseum is within walking distance of most hotels. You can also take a taxi to the venue, or drive yourself to take advantage of valet parking or the self-parking garage. Once inside, the Colosseum is located on the casino floor across from the Forum Food Court and Gordon Ramsay Pub and Grill.

When to Get There
The box office is open from 11am to 7pm on non-show nights and from 11am to 8pm on show nights. Concerts typically begin at 7:30pm. A detailed schedule can be found at the box office or on the shows page on the Caesars Palace website.
The Acoustics at the Colosseum
The Colosseum was built to replicate its ancient Roman counterpart in superficial design only; the hall boasts world-class acoustics. 200 acoustic panels create an intimate feeling throughout the theater, ensuring the best auditory experience regardless of where you sit. Plus, even the furthest seats in the theater are a mere 120 feet (36 meters) from the stage, meaning you’ll have a decent view no matter where your positioned.
